• 0
منال 1801

كيفية ربط النماذج بقاعدة البيانات في php

سؤال

السلام عليكم و رحمة الله تعالى و بركاته

اخواني الكرام انا بحاجة الى مساعدتكم في كود php

انا عندي فورم عبارة عن 3 قوائم

221405296.png

و حابة كل ما اختار يجيبلي من قاعدة البيانات التفسير

علما ان قاعدة البيانات تتكون من جدولين

جدول السور : soura (id_s , name_s)

جدول الايات : aya ( id_a , id_s , tafsir )

ارجو المساعدة في اقرب وقت انا في الانتظاااار

جزاكم الله خيرا و جعلها في ميزان حسناتكم

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

4 إجابة على هذا السؤال .

  • 0

اين انتم يا اخوان , هل السؤال غير مفهوم ؟

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

شرحها يطول :(

على كل , عليكي إظهار السور والآيات والتفاسير من قاعدة البيانات , وعندما أقوم بإختيار سورة معينه تظهر في القائمة الخاصه بالآيات عدد الآيات الخاصه بها من قاعدة البيانات وذلك من خلال المعرف الخاص بالسورة وعند الضغط على فسر أو نفذ يقوم ملف البي أتش بي بالبحث عن تفسير الآيه المطلوبه من خلال رقم المعرف الخاص بها والذي تم استقباله من الفورم .

يمكنكي استخدام الأجاكس في عرض الآيات عند إختيار السورة لكي تكون العمليه بالنسبه للمستخدم غير ممله

لو لدي الوقت الكافي لأرفقت مثال ولكن أعذريني فأنا مشغول جدا

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

السلام عليكم و رحمة الله تعالى و بركاته

اخي الكريم شكرا جزيلا لك على الرد لكن انا اعرف الطريقة التي يتم بها الامر نظريا

و الذي اريده هو الكود فأنا لازلت مبتدئة في ال php

مع جزيل الشكر و الامتنان

0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ه
  • 0

سأقوم بتوضيح العملية . اولا html


<form method="POST" action="index.php">

<p><select size="1" name="D1">
<option>select name</option>
</select></p>
<p><input type="submit" value="Submit" name="B1"></p>
</form>

قمنا بعمل تحويل الفورم الى ملف index.php كما موضح بالـ action

اسم نموذج التحديد D1

الـ methood = POST

الان نأتي لملف index.php وظيفته ادخال البيانات


<?php
include ("config.php");
$select1= $_POST['D1'];

mysql_query("INSERT INTO Persons ( select1 )
VALUES ('$select1')");

mysql_close($con);

?>

الان طريقة عرض البيانات من القاعده :


<?php
include ("config.php");
$result = mysql_query("SELECT * FROM Persons");

while($row = mysql_fetch_array($result))
{
echo $row['select1'] ;
}

mysql_close($con);


?>

ارجوا ان المعلومات تفيدك . وبالتوفيق

تم تعديل بواسطه rixlinux
0

شارك هذا الرد


رابط المشاركة
شارك الرد من خلال المواقع ادناه

من فضلك سجل دخول لتتمكن من التعليق

ستتمكن من اضافه تعليقات بعد التسجيل



سجل دخولك الان

  • يستعرض القسم حالياً   0 members

    لا يوجد أعضاء مسجلين يشاهدون هذه الصفحة .